NASCAR DFS Prop Picks: FireKeepers Casino 400 - Monkey Knife Fight

Sunday afternoon features the FireKeepers Casino 400 at the Michigan International Speedway from Brooklyn, Michigan. Monkey Knife Fight has an extremely easy fantasy point system: 0.1 points for each lap led and then a set amount of points for their position (20 for 1st place, 19 for 2nd place, 18 for 3rd, and so on).
